
The virtual gambling sector has seen a significant transformation in recent times, with withdrawal speed becoming a key differentiator among platforms. Players no longer tolerate the seven-day waiting periods that once marked this industry. According to authenticated industry data, the average withdrawal processing time has decreased from 5-7 business days in 2015 to as few as 24 hours in 2024, web site with some platforms attaining even faster turnarounds.
The infrastructure supporting rapid fund transfers relies on several technological innovations working in unison. Modern platforms use automated verification systems that immediately authenticate player identities through artificial intelligence document scanning and biometric recognition. This eradicates the traditional manual review bottleneck that historically postponed transactions by 48-72 hours.
Blockchain technology has emerged as a transformative force in accelerating payment processing. Cryptocurrency withdrawals bypass traditional banking intermediaries, enabling peer-to-peer transactions that finalize within minutes rather than days. The peer-to-peer nature of these systems functions continuously without banking hour restrictions or weekend delays.

Identity Verification Status
Account verification status represents the single most influential factor determining payout velocity. Platforms typically employ a tiered system where fully verified accounts receive preferential processing. Fully verified players often enjoy instant or same-day withdrawals, while unverified accounts may face delays reaching several business days.
Licensing Jurisdiction Requirements
Regulatory frameworks require varying compliance obligations that influence processing timelines. Platforms functioning under tight regulatory oversight must conduct mandatory security checks, responsible gambling assessments, and AML screenings before transferring funds. These protective measures, while valuable for player security, necessarily prolong processing duration.

Sophisticated platforms have teamed up with specialized payment aggregators enabling instant settlement capabilities. These third-party processors hold pre-funded merchant accounts that allow immediate player payouts, with the platform settling accounts on the backend. This architectural approach separates player satisfaction from traditional banking delays.
Open banking initiatives in progressive jurisdictions have even more accelerated direct bank account transfers. Through secure API connections, platforms can launch real-time payments directly into player accounts without middle holding periods. This technology remains geography-dependent but represents the upcoming trajectory of payment processing.
Velocity optimization must equilibrate against fraud prevention requirements. Platforms processing instant withdrawals utilize sophisticated behavioral analytics monitoring unusual withdrawal patterns, geolocation anomalies, and account access irregularities. Artificial intelligence algorithms continuously optimize risk models, separating legitimate urgent requests from potentially fraudulent activities.
The quickest platforms operate robust customer support infrastructure equipped to resolving payment queries in real-time. Online chat systems run by payment specialists can immediately address verification issues, documentation deficiencies, or technical obstacles preventing instant processing. This human element remains critical despite increasing automation.
